For a day trip to Kilkenny City, you can easily access the town via public transport from several locations
across Ireland. Direct trains to Kilkenny are available not just from Dublin's Heuston Station but also from
cities like Waterford and Carlow, offering smooth connections with travel times typically under 90 minutes.
Bus Éireann and other private operators provide extensive bus routes to Kilkenny from key locations such as
Cork, Limerick, Waterford, and Athlone, in addition to Dublin. These bus services are ideal for a scenic
journey and connect smaller towns like Thomastown, Graiguenamanagh, and Callan to Kilkenny, making it
accessible from a wide range of destinations.
